Publisher's Synopsis

Navigating Drama is designed for all students studying Drama in Years 9 and 10. The form and content of the teaching programs included reflects the aims and outcomes of the new NSW Board of Studies Drama 7-10 elective course, though it could be used for syllabuses nationwide. The core area of playbuilding is supplemented with an in-depth and integrated study of key dramatic contexts to help students navigate their path through making, performing and appreciating drama. There are in-depth study of Commedia dell'arte and mask work, Melodrama and Australian Melodrama, Australian drama, playwrighting, how to write you own scripts and a comprehensive guide to analyzing, choosing, rehearsing and performing ccripted drama scenes.
